I recently visited Dosa House and had a delightful experience.Their self-ordering system is incredibly convenient, allowing you to simply place your order and wait.I particularly enjoyed their Mysore Masala Dosa, which was both flavorful and generously sized.The Vada Sambar also stood out as a delicious choice.Overall, the food was excellent, offering great value for the portion sizes.Additionally, the unexpected sweet accompaniment with the dosa was a pleasant surprise.I highly recommend Dosa House for a satisfying dining experience.Vegetarian options: It's a complete vegetarian restaurantDietary restrictions: YesParking: Free parking lot available. Might get crowded on busy daysKid-friendliness: YesWheelchair accessibility: Yes
